Situated in the heart of the Mid-Atlantic region, Hampton has a rich history and exciting background that keeps growing and becoming more charming. Although the city may be historic, the youthful atmosphere here brings plenty of people into Hampton apartments for rent. With its seaside location and easy access to Norfolk and Virginia Beach, you better be prepared to enjoy the water when you move into one of the man apartments for rent in Hampton! This city is a true gem that appreciates families, has a warm and welcoming vibe and is sure to continue to thrive.
According to the U.S. Census, the city is home to more than 137,000 people, so small-city living is what to expect when you find yourself looking into Hampton apartment for rent. Around 23 percent of the residents here are also 18 or younger, showing that this is a very popular spot for young families. Attractions in Hampton are literally surrounding you, since the city sits on a beautiful bay overlooking the Atlantic Ocean. Some of the most exciting places to explore here are the Virginia Air and Space Center and historic Fort Wool. People who live in Hampton apartments can also enjoy many community events, including the International Children's Festival, Groovin' By The Bay - a series of music acts that happens on the beach on Sundays during the summer - and Storytelling In The Park.
Despite having a significant amount of waterfront property, the cost of living for people in Hampton apartments for rent is surprisingly affordable. According to City-Data, the index is around 98, which is less than the United States' current rate. AreaVibes gave Hampton a score of 81, because the city excels in low cost of living, has fantastic weather and a stable housing market and provides lots of great amenities for people living in apartments in Hampton.
According to the city's website, some of the biggest employers for people living in apartments in Hampton include NASA's Langley Research Center and Langley Air Force Base. However, Alcoa Howmet, Sentara Healthcare System and the National Institute of Aerospace are also prominent employers in the area. You can tell from the list of employers that the military and aeronautical industry play a big role in the city's employment, because there is a history of soldiers and military families living here. The city's largest and most popular institution is Hampton University, which sits on a historic campus and offers technical, liberal arts and graduate degree programs. However, Thomas Nelson Community College is also an option for students who are seeking two-year degrees.
